What Is Responsive Design?

Responsive design is a web design approach that allows a website to automatically adapt its layout, content, images, and functionality based on the screen size of the device being used.

Instead of building separate desktop and mobile websites, responsive web design creates one flexible website that adjusts dynamically across all devices.

Whether someone visits your website using:

  • A smartphone
  • A tablet
  • A laptop
  • A desktop monitor

Your website should still look clean, organized, and easy to navigate.

Responsive websites use flexible grids, scalable images, and adaptive layouts to ensure users get the best possible browsing experience regardless of screen size.

Responsive Design Helps Your SEO Rankings

Responsive design plays a major role in search engine optimization.

Google prioritizes mobile-friendly websites because it wants to provide users with the best possible browsing experience. In fact, Google uses mobile-first indexing, meaning it primarily evaluates the mobile version of your website for ranking purposes.

A responsive website can help improve:

  • Mobile usability
  • Page speed
  • User engagement
  • Crawlability
  • Bounce rates

All of these factors contribute to stronger SEO performance.

If your website is difficult to use on mobile devices, your rankings may suffer, even if your content is strong.

That’s why responsive design is considered a critical part of modern SEO strategies.

Easier Website Management

Managing multiple versions of a website can become complicated and expensive.

Before responsive design became common, businesses often maintained separate desktop and mobile websites. This created extra work for:

  • Updates
  • Content management
  • SEO optimization
  • Bug fixes
  • Design changes

Responsive design simplifies everything by allowing you to manage a single website across all devices.

This saves time, reduces maintenance costs, and ensures consistency throughout your website.
